What kind of strings did Eddie Van Halen use?

Initially, Eddie used his own mixture of Fender strings, heavy on top, lighter on the bottom. This ended up not working very well, so instead Eddie Van Halen changed to a regular set of strings. He used Fender Heavy Strings to begin with, later on changing to Fender 150XL gauge strings.

Is Wolfgang Standard worth it?

The Verdict If you’ve always wanted a Wolfgang but have limited funds, the Wolfgang Standard is a dream. It gives you all the key ingredients of the Van Halen flavor—high-output pickups, compound radius fretboard, locking tremolo system—at a price that’s hard to beat.

When did EVH leave Peavey?

Peavey had a good run with Eddie Van Halen and the Wolfgang model, although he left to form his own company, EVH, in 2004. Peavey began building Ed’s 5150 amps in 1992 and produced a prototype guitar for him that helped lure him over from Ernie Ball Music Man.
